Here's my entry. It's my first ever build and I think it turned out OK. An ES-1F finished in 2K clearcoat with a combination of black & blue fabric dyes and green food colouring underneath! Let's see how the colours hold up. Should be OK because of the UV protection in 2K clearcoat. I opted for the gold hardware, bone nut and Grover locking tuners.
I'm not sure if you can ever say a self-build guitar is ever truly "finished" but it's finished for now. Looks OK and plays OK. The Law of Diminishing Returns certainly came into play on this! I'd say the final 20% to about 80% of the time. One thing I can say for sure is that you really don't save money by building your own. I could have bought a very nice finished guitar for less, but that's not the point. It gave me something to do for a couple of months on & off, I have the guitar I want and I have the feeling of achievement that the thing actually works and sounds good.
